Your e-commerce glossary

All the terms you need to know to succeed in modern e-commerce, explained simply and clearly.

Back to Glossary

What is Omnichannel?

Omnichannel refers to a seamless and integrated customer experience across multiple channels, including online stores, physical stores, social media, apps, and more.

Explanation

Omnichannel is a customer-centric strategy that ensures consistent and unified engagement across all touchpoints, regardless of how or where a customer interacts with a brand.

Importance

  • Enhanced Customer Experience: Creates a frictionless shopping journey, improving satisfaction.
  • Increased Customer Loyalty: Builds trust with consistent messaging and personalized experiences.
  • Higher Revenue Potential: Encourages customers to engage through multiple channels, increasing sales.
  • Better Data Utilization: Collects and analyzes customer data across channels for actionable insights.

How It Works

  • Unified Customer Profiles: Centralize customer data for personalized recommendations.
  • Channel Integration: Connect physical stores, e-commerce platforms, and apps seamlessly.
  • Real-Time Inventory Updates: Provide accurate product availability across all touchpoints.
  • Consistent Messaging: Maintain cohesive branding and communication on every platform.
  • Data-Driven Personalization: Tailor offers and experiences based on customer behavior.

Benefits

  • Improved Engagement: Customers can shop and interact with your brand anytime, anywhere.
  • Higher Conversion Rates: A consistent and personalized experience boosts purchase likelihood.
  • Enhanced Brand Perception: Builds credibility with cohesive cross-channel integration.
  • Streamlined Operations: Simplifies inventory and customer data management.
  • Expanded Reach: Captures audiences across various platforms, increasing market coverage.